FBI Reports $21 Billion Cybercrime Loss in US: Key Attack Vectors
The FBI's IC3 report reveals Americans lost a record $21 billion to cybercrime, primarily due to investment scams, BEC, tech support fraud, and data breaches.

Project Compass: Arrests Target 'The Com' Cybercrime Collective
Global law enforcement operation 'Project Compass' results in 30 arrests and identifies 180 members of 'The Com' cybercriminal collective, disrupting its operations.

Interpol’s Operation Red Card 2.0: 651 Arrests Targeting Cybercrime
INTERPOL and AFRIPOL's Operation Red Card 2.0 disrupts West African cybercrime syndicates, leading to 651 arrests and $4.3 million in seized funds.
